Daniel Baumann [Mon, 17 Dec 2012 19:30:06 +0000 (20:30 +0100)]
Releasing debian version 3.0~b3-1.
Daniel Baumann [Mon, 17 Dec 2012 12:51:44 +0000 (13:51 +0100)]
Removing kubuntu mode, it's not different anymore to standard ubuntu mode.
Daniel Baumann [Mon, 17 Dec 2012 12:43:16 +0000 (13:43 +0100)]
Removing some dead default handling code for global includes which do not exist anymore.
Daniel Baumann [Mon, 17 Dec 2012 12:40:28 +0000 (13:40 +0100)]
Correcting config tree version check for the current version.
Daniel Baumann [Mon, 17 Dec 2012 12:36:27 +0000 (13:36 +0100)]
Correcting config tree version check for older versions.
Daniel Baumann [Sun, 16 Dec 2012 23:20:50 +0000 (00:20 +0100)]
Renumbering hooks.
Daniel Baumann [Sun, 16 Dec 2012 23:15:38 +0000 (00:15 +0100)]
Merging remove-linux-image-backups into remove-backup-files hook.
Daniel Baumann [Sun, 16 Dec 2012 23:10:31 +0000 (00:10 +0100)]
Adding default hook to use mesa glx renderer.
Daniel Baumann [Sun, 16 Dec 2012 23:08:41 +0000 (00:08 +0100)]
Using consistent naming for default hooks.
Daniel Baumann [Sun, 16 Dec 2012 23:06:33 +0000 (00:06 +0100)]
Adding default hook to use newest nvidia version.
Daniel Baumann [Sun, 16 Dec 2012 23:00:11 +0000 (00:00 +0100)]
Also removing man chache in remove-temporary-files hook.
Daniel Baumann [Sun, 16 Dec 2012 22:58:54 +0000 (23:58 +0100)]
Adding default hook to truncate log files.
Daniel Baumann [Sun, 16 Dec 2012 22:56:34 +0000 (23:56 +0100)]
Moving removal of backup and temporary files to their own hook script.
Daniel Baumann [Sun, 16 Dec 2012 22:51:01 +0000 (23:51 +0100)]
Marking loop-aes-utils related hack as squeeze only.
Daniel Baumann [Sun, 16 Dec 2012 22:48:24 +0000 (23:48 +0100)]
Moving kexec-tools default preseeding into its own hook script.
Daniel Baumann [Sun, 16 Dec 2012 22:43:48 +0000 (23:43 +0100)]
Removing old code in chroot_hacks for tasks which are not used anymore.
Daniel Baumann [Sun, 16 Dec 2012 20:57:52 +0000 (21:57 +0100)]
Releasing debian version 3.0~b2-1.
Daniel Baumann [Sun, 16 Dec 2012 20:06:25 +0000 (21:06 +0100)]
Switching from genisoimage to xorriso.
Richard Nelson [Fri, 14 Dec 2012 23:40:16 +0000 (17:40 -0600)]
Update l-b-cgi frontend to support new git config structure.
Daniel Baumann [Thu, 13 Dec 2012 19:32:05 +0000 (20:32 +0100)]
Updating removal of adjtime in a split out hook for wheezy.
Daniel Baumann [Thu, 13 Dec 2012 18:04:14 +0000 (19:04 +0100)]
Avoid re-populating an already populated configuration tree when using lb config --config.
Daniel Baumann [Thu, 13 Dec 2012 17:51:54 +0000 (18:51 +0100)]
Adding support for live-images configs and arbitrary configuration directories in lb_config --config option.
Daniel Baumann [Thu, 13 Dec 2012 17:24:08 +0000 (18:24 +0100)]
Correcting spelling typo in bug script.
Daniel Baumann [Wed, 12 Dec 2012 10:43:39 +0000 (11:43 +0100)]
Adding default hook to remove mdadm configuration.
mdadm creates a /etc/mdadm/mdadm.conf configuration file
on package installation which contains array information
from the build system.
Daniel Baumann [Tue, 11 Dec 2012 19:34:57 +0000 (20:34 +0100)]
Removing not really useful symlinks example hook.
Daniel Baumann [Mon, 10 Dec 2012 21:30:46 +0000 (22:30 +0100)]
Updating wheezy release number.
Daniel Baumann [Mon, 10 Dec 2012 19:39:08 +0000 (20:39 +0100)]
Releasing debian version 3.0~b1-1.
Daniel Baumann [Mon, 10 Dec 2012 19:37:26 +0000 (20:37 +0100)]
Skipping creation of soon to be replaced config/templates directory.
Daniel Baumann [Mon, 10 Dec 2012 19:35:50 +0000 (20:35 +0100)]
Removing local/bin by default in lb_clean too.
Raphaël Hertzog [Thu, 6 Dec 2012 09:50:25 +0000 (10:50 +0100)]
Adding initial menu entries for debian-installer.
Daniel Baumann [Thu, 6 Dec 2012 20:09:25 +0000 (21:09 +0100)]
Releasing debian version 3.0~a69-1.
Daniel Baumann [Thu, 6 Dec 2012 19:59:35 +0000 (20:59 +0100)]
Adding back legacy filtering for firmware packages on squeeze when contrib or non-free is not enabled.
Daniel Baumann [Thu, 6 Dec 2012 19:45:48 +0000 (20:45 +0100)]
Dropping ubuntu guards on firmware selection code, we're not enabling firmware inclusion in ubuntu mode anyway.
Also, we're not keeping this as ubuntu should just update their archive
structure for content files to match debian. Not worth keeping temporary
extra turns just for ubuntu.
Daniel Baumann [Tue, 4 Dec 2012 11:49:15 +0000 (12:49 +0100)]
Adding proper header to build.sh include.
Daniel Baumann [Tue, 4 Dec 2012 11:47:40 +0000 (12:47 +0100)]
Ensuring that functions are either sources locally or globally, but not both.
Daniel Baumann [Tue, 4 Dec 2012 11:07:51 +0000 (12:07 +0100)]
Adding support for local apt conf.d snippets in archive definitions (Closes: #685791).
Daniel Baumann [Tue, 4 Dec 2012 11:04:47 +0000 (12:04 +0100)]
Harmonizing apt configuration handling in chroot_archives.
Daniel Baumann [Tue, 4 Dec 2012 10:31:01 +0000 (11:31 +0100)]
Correcting test for no config tree version number to match all other cases, not just lower-than-1.
Daniel Baumann [Tue, 4 Dec 2012 10:25:51 +0000 (11:25 +0100)]
Updating wording about regenerating config trees.
Daniel Baumann [Sat, 1 Dec 2012 00:56:32 +0000 (01:56 +0100)]
Adding dropped empty-line separator in binary_debian-installer.
Daniel Baumann [Sat, 1 Dec 2012 00:55:30 +0000 (01:55 +0100)]
Adding dropped empty-line separator in defaults.
Daniel Baumann [Sat, 1 Dec 2012 00:50:23 +0000 (01:50 +0100)]
Updating powerpc kernel list on ubuntu.
Daniel Baumann [Sat, 1 Dec 2012 00:44:29 +0000 (01:44 +0100)]
Removing some leftovers from stripped and minimal package lists.
Daniel Baumann [Fri, 30 Nov 2012 14:29:20 +0000 (15:29 +0100)]
Also avoiding to use xz compression for squashfs for kubuntu.
Daniel Baumann [Fri, 30 Nov 2012 14:10:13 +0000 (15:10 +0100)]
Releasing debian version 3.0~a68-1.
Daniel Baumann [Fri, 30 Nov 2012 14:08:27 +0000 (15:08 +0100)]
Replicating same qemu support within bootstrap_debootstrao for bootstrap_cdebootstrap too (Closes: #694102).
Daniel Baumann [Fri, 30 Nov 2012 14:06:57 +0000 (15:06 +0100)]
Using hash rather than pipe as sed separator for writing boot parameters into bootloader configurations (Closes: #694723).
Daniel Baumann [Thu, 29 Nov 2012 20:36:38 +0000 (21:36 +0100)]
Adding dpkg-source local options.
Daniel Baumann [Wed, 28 Nov 2012 16:48:01 +0000 (17:48 +0100)]
Using four letter digit prefixes for hooks like for consistency with all other live packages.
Daniel Baumann [Wed, 28 Nov 2012 16:43:29 +0000 (17:43 +0100)]
Adding default hook to remove linux-image backup files.
Daniel Baumann [Wed, 28 Nov 2012 08:31:29 +0000 (09:31 +0100)]
Updating note about integrity check boot parameter within checksum files.
Daniel Baumann [Wed, 28 Nov 2012 08:30:46 +0000 (09:30 +0100)]
Marking comments in checksum files as such to avoid harmless but anoying warning messages during live-boots medium integrity check.
Richard Nelson [Thu, 22 Nov 2012 21:32:27 +0000 (15:32 -0600)]
Richard Nelson [Thu, 22 Nov 2012 21:05:42 +0000 (15:05 -0600)]
Daniel Baumann [Thu, 22 Nov 2012 16:11:00 +0000 (17:11 +0100)]
Adding default-preseeding for non-free firmware only when non-free is actually included, to avoid cluttering debconf db by default on all systems.
Daniel Baumann [Thu, 22 Nov 2012 16:07:35 +0000 (17:07 +0100)]
Adding backwards compatible handling for squeeze and the ubuntus for old-style Contents files in the archive.
Richard Nelson [Tue, 20 Nov 2012 02:28:32 +0000 (20:28 -0600)]
Increased the maxlenth of the entry field cgipackages.list.chroot on l-b.cgi (Closes: #693732).
Richard Nelson [Tue, 20 Nov 2012 02:05:22 +0000 (20:05 -0600)]
Update git paths for cgi form.
Daniel Baumann [Mon, 19 Nov 2012 15:21:19 +0000 (16:21 +0100)]
Correcting a typo in chroot_apt when re-configuring apt preferences, found by Thanatermesis <thanatermesis@gmail.com> (Closes: #685924).
Daniel Baumann [Wed, 14 Nov 2012 20:54:42 +0000 (21:54 +0100)]
Correcting copying of archive specific apt preferences files, thanks to Thanatermesis <thanatermesis@gmail.com> (Closes: #693250).
Ben Armstrong [Wed, 14 Nov 2012 14:08:38 +0000 (10:08 -0400)]
Fixing typo in cache directory names, thanks to Thanatermesis <thanatermesis@gmail.com>.
Daniel Baumann [Fri, 2 Nov 2012 11:28:39 +0000 (12:28 +0100)]
Releasing debian version 3.0~a67-1.
Daniel Baumann [Fri, 2 Nov 2012 10:50:44 +0000 (11:50 +0100)]
Workarounding recent archive changes wrt/ content files until #692111 is fixed.
Daniel Baumann [Wed, 31 Oct 2012 14:16:14 +0000 (15:16 +0100)]
Correcting typos in aptitude-options name in lb config, thanks to Frank Gard <frank@familie-gard.de> (Closes: #691930).
Daniel Baumann [Wed, 31 Oct 2012 08:26:25 +0000 (09:26 +0100)]
Removing debconf-nowarnings option, doesn't provide any advantage to disable this option in the first place.
Daniel Baumann [Wed, 31 Oct 2012 06:48:26 +0000 (07:48 +0100)]
Also supporting the other way around: removing systemd from a bootstrap and switching to sysvinit for those distributions that default to systemd.
Daniel Baumann [Wed, 31 Oct 2012 06:45:55 +0000 (07:45 +0100)]
Making sysvinit removal on systemd systems conditional, newer bootstraps might not always pull in sysvinit packages anymore.
Daniel Baumann [Wed, 31 Oct 2012 06:43:37 +0000 (07:43 +0100)]
Running chrooted commands with DEBCONF_NONINTERACTIVE_SEEN set to true to ensure debconf questions are not reasked uselessly on the final systems.
Daniel Baumann [Mon, 29 Oct 2012 18:45:17 +0000 (19:45 +0100)]
Removing sysvinit when building images with systemd.
Daniel Baumann [Sun, 28 Oct 2012 10:46:01 +0000 (11:46 +0100)]
Shortening initsystem specific hacks for wheezy, systemd on squeeze never was really supported anyway.
Daniel Baumann [Sun, 28 Oct 2012 10:42:57 +0000 (11:42 +0100)]
Defaulting to systemd as initsystem for wheezy based progress-linux releases and newer.
Daniel Baumann [Sat, 27 Oct 2012 21:37:35 +0000 (23:37 +0200)]
Using xargs when copying or hardlinking deb files from and to the package cache to avoid hit the shell max command limits (Closes: #691616).
Daniel Baumann [Sat, 27 Oct 2012 21:06:52 +0000 (23:06 +0200)]
Removing cruft line breaks in bailout messages for bootstrap tools.
Daniel Baumann [Fri, 26 Oct 2012 08:58:48 +0000 (10:58 +0200)]
Removing workaround for #657560 where we had to temporarily include bzip2 into the bootstrapped chroot to avoid sids apt failing on mirrors with bzip2 indices only.
Daniel Baumann [Thu, 25 Oct 2012 12:00:33 +0000 (14:00 +0200)]
Removing unecessary removal of apt preferences.
When we rebuild an image with changed local archives,
we would preferably remove the already existing preferences files.
However, there's no way to make sure that we remove enough or too
much, hence we don't remove any at all and stay with the dogma:
"If you change something in the config tree affecting $stage,
you need to rebuild that stage from scratch."
So for pinning changes for local archives, this means, since it's
affecting the chroot stage, we'll have to rebuild the chroot stage:
"lb clean --chroot && lb chroot"
Daniel Baumann [Thu, 25 Oct 2012 11:36:12 +0000 (13:36 +0200)]
Renaming progress mode to progress-linux to match the used naming scheme.
chals [Wed, 24 Oct 2012 12:18:26 +0000 (14:18 +0200)]
Addin missing comma in the long debootstrap-options that caused an unrecognized option message.
Daniel Baumann [Mon, 22 Oct 2012 18:45:11 +0000 (20:45 +0200)]
Releasing debian version 3.0~a66-1.
Daniel Baumann [Mon, 22 Oct 2012 18:43:21 +0000 (20:43 +0200)]
Renaming config/includes.binary_debian-installer to simply config/includes.debian-installer.
Daniel Baumann [Mon, 22 Oct 2012 18:41:40 +0000 (20:41 +0200)]
Renaming config/binary_rootfs to simply config/rootfs.
Daniel Baumann [Mon, 22 Oct 2012 18:36:17 +0000 (20:36 +0200)]
Avoid creating old left-over directory for custom syslinux splash handing from within the config tree in lb_config.
Daniel Baumann [Mon, 22 Oct 2012 18:34:10 +0000 (20:34 +0200)]
Removing support for local grub/grub2 splash image and config manipulations, custom templates should be used instead.
Rather than doing all the heavy lifting in live-build that nobody really
uses and which is quite inflexible, users should (in line with the syslinux
handling) either stick with the default grub configurations, or, supply
a custom one to live-build, rather than partial/single files only.
Daniel Baumann [Mon, 22 Oct 2012 18:30:41 +0000 (20:30 +0200)]
Renaming config/binary_debian-installer to simply config/debian-installer.
Daniel Baumann [Mon, 22 Oct 2012 18:27:13 +0000 (20:27 +0200)]
Renaming config/chroot_apt to simply config/apt.
Eventually lb_chroot_apt will be folded into chroot_archives
but that's left for after wheezy.
Daniel Baumann [Mon, 22 Oct 2012 17:20:12 +0000 (19:20 +0200)]
Renaming local/scripts to local/bin for executables overriding not just lb scripts, but any command during live-build runs.
Daniel Baumann [Mon, 22 Oct 2012 17:18:06 +0000 (19:18 +0200)]
Removing local/functions functionality, it's not really usefull anyway.
Daniel Baumann [Mon, 22 Oct 2012 17:14:01 +0000 (19:14 +0200)]
Removing some left-overs from bootstrap-copy removal in lb config.
Daniel Baumann [Mon, 8 Oct 2012 18:47:10 +0000 (20:47 +0200)]
Releasing debian version 3.0~a65-1.
Daniel Baumann [Mon, 8 Oct 2012 18:16:40 +0000 (20:16 +0200)]
Correcting variable handling for --bootappend-live-failsafe in defaults.
Daniel Baumann [Mon, 8 Oct 2012 18:01:30 +0000 (20:01 +0200)]
Simplifying bootparameter assembling in defaults.
Daniel Baumann [Mon, 8 Oct 2012 18:00:41 +0000 (20:00 +0200)]
Stopping to support LB_INITRAMFS=auto, when switching the mode one has to update several parameters anyway, use of auto scripts are recommended.
Daniel Baumann [Mon, 8 Oct 2012 17:51:23 +0000 (19:51 +0200)]
Correcting variable handling for --bootappend-live-failsafe in lb config.
Daniel Baumann [Fri, 5 Oct 2012 07:23:53 +0000 (09:23 +0200)]
Releasing debian version 3.0~a64-1.
Daniel Baumann [Thu, 4 Oct 2012 18:13:25 +0000 (20:13 +0200)]
Setting default compression to none.
Normally, when using compressed file systems (squashfs),
there is no point in further compressing the tarballs and images.
Daniel Baumann [Thu, 4 Oct 2012 12:26:44 +0000 (14:26 +0200)]
Making different boot options defaults depending on initramfs generator, not depending on mode.
Daniel Baumann [Thu, 4 Oct 2012 12:24:36 +0000 (14:24 +0200)]
Making failsafe boot parameters fully customizable like the normal ones.
Daniel Baumann [Wed, 3 Oct 2012 14:00:51 +0000 (16:00 +0200)]
Adding note about experimental in cgi frontend package description.
Daniel Baumann [Wed, 3 Oct 2012 13:58:44 +0000 (15:58 +0200)]
Updating package descriptions.
Michal Suchanek [Wed, 3 Oct 2012 12:20:36 +0000 (14:20 +0200)]
Allowing to include multiple kernel images but menu entry is generated only for one.
Daniel Baumann [Wed, 3 Oct 2012 11:49:25 +0000 (13:49 +0200)]
Removing ubuntu natty support, EOL.